How can a kitchen remodel increase functionality?
A kitchen remodel can significantly enhance functionality by optimizing the layout and incorporating modern features that streamline cooking and organization. By focusing on elements like open-concept designs, smart storage, and upgraded appliances, homeowners can create a more efficient and enjoyable cooking environment.
Open-concept layouts
Open-concept layouts eliminate barriers between the kitchen and adjacent living spaces, promoting better flow and interaction. This design allows for easier movement and can make a small kitchen feel larger and more inviting.
When considering an open-concept remodel, think about how the kitchen will integrate with dining and living areas. Use furniture and decor to define spaces while maintaining an overall cohesive look.
Smart storage solutions
Incorporating smart storage solutions maximizes space and keeps the kitchen organized. Options like pull-out shelves, deep drawers, and vertical storage can help utilize every inch of cabinetry effectively.
Consider adding features such as lazy Susans or pull-out pantry systems to make accessing items easier. These enhancements can reduce clutter and improve overall efficiency in the kitchen.
Efficient work zones
Creating efficient work zones involves organizing the kitchen into specific areas for cooking, prep, and cleaning. This zoning allows for a more streamlined workflow and minimizes unnecessary movement.
When planning your remodel, ensure that the sink, stove, and refrigerator are positioned in a convenient triangle layout. This classic design principle can significantly enhance cooking efficiency.
Multi-functional islands
A multi-functional island serves as a central hub for cooking, dining, and socializing. It can provide additional prep space, storage, and seating, making it a versatile addition to any kitchen.
When designing an island, consider incorporating features like a built-in cooktop or a sink to enhance its functionality. Ensure it is proportionate to the kitchen size to maintain a balanced look.
Upgraded appliances
Upgrading to modern appliances can improve energy efficiency and enhance cooking capabilities. Look for appliances with high energy ratings that offer advanced features like smart technology or multi-functionality.
Investing in quality appliances can also add value to your home. Consider brands that offer warranties and reliable customer service to ensure long-term satisfaction with your choices.

How does a kitchen remodel enhance property value?
A kitchen remodel can significantly enhance property value by modernizing the space, improving functionality, and appealing to potential buyers. Upgraded kitchens often yield a strong return on investment, making them a smart choice for homeowners looking to increase their property’s market worth.
Return on investment statistics
On average, homeowners can expect to recoup about 60% to 80% of their kitchen remodel costs when selling their home. This percentage can vary based on the extent of the renovation, the quality of materials used, and the local real estate market conditions. Minor remodels typically offer higher returns compared to extensive renovations.
Market demand for updated kitchens
There is a consistent market demand for updated kitchens, as they are often seen as the heart of the home. Buyers prioritize modern appliances, open layouts, and stylish finishes, making an updated kitchen a key selling point. Homes with outdated kitchens may linger on the market longer and sell for less.
Impact on home appraisal
A kitchen remodel can positively influence home appraisals, as appraisers consider the condition and appeal of the kitchen when determining property value. High-quality renovations can lead to higher appraised values, which is beneficial for refinancing or selling. It’s essential to ensure that the remodel aligns with neighborhood standards to maximize appraisal benefits.
Buyer preferences in major cities
In major cities, buyer preferences often lean towards open-concept kitchens with modern amenities and eco-friendly features. Urban buyers typically seek spaces that are not only functional but also aesthetically pleasing. Features such as quartz countertops, energy-efficient appliances, and ample storage are highly desirable, making them essential considerations during a remodel.

What are the key criteria for a successful kitchen remodel?
A successful kitchen remodel focuses on enhancing functionality, achieving modern aesthetics, and increasing property value. Key criteria include setting a realistic budget, thorough design planning, and selecting qualified contractors to ensure the project meets your goals.
Budget considerations
Establishing a budget is crucial for a kitchen remodel. Consider allocating around 10-15% of your home’s value for this project, which typically covers materials, labor, and unexpected expenses. Be prepared for potential cost overruns, as unforeseen issues may arise during renovations.
Prioritize your spending by identifying which elements are most important to you, such as high-quality appliances or custom cabinetry. This will help you make informed choices and avoid overspending on less critical aspects.
Design planning
Effective design planning is essential for maximizing both functionality and aesthetics in your kitchen. Start by assessing your current layout and identifying areas for improvement, such as workflow efficiency and storage solutions. Consider creating zones for cooking, preparation, and entertaining.
Incorporate modern design elements that reflect your style, such as open shelving, sleek countertops, and contemporary lighting fixtures. Utilize design software or consult with a designer to visualize your ideas and ensure a cohesive look throughout the space.
Choosing the right contractors
Selecting qualified contractors can significantly impact the success of your kitchen remodel. Research potential candidates by checking their credentials, reading reviews, and asking for references from previous clients. Ensure they have experience with kitchen renovations and are familiar with local building codes.
Communicate your vision clearly and request detailed estimates to compare costs and services. Establish a timeline and ensure that the contractor is committed to meeting deadlines while maintaining quality workmanship. Regular check-ins during the project can help keep everything on track.
